Request for Question Clarification by leapinglizard-ga on 26 Nov 2004 08:45 PST
There is no three-star hotel in New York City that charges $200 for
one room. You should either expect to spend several times that figure,
or lower your sights and settle for a one-star hotel. If you want to
be near the Empire State Building, the part of town you're interested
in is called midtown. If you say "Central New York", it sounds like
you're looking for a hotel room in the middle of New York State. You
should instead say that you want a room in "New York City midtown".
